Carbon Filter Installation in Jacksonville, FL

Carbon filter installation services involve adding specialized filters to existing HVAC systems or standalone units to improve indoor air quality. These filters are designed to remove odors, airborne chemicals, and pollutants such as smoke, pet dander, and volatile organic compounds (VOCs). Property owners often request this service for projects like upgrading ventilation systems, reducing persistent odors from cooking or pets, or addressing concerns about indoor air cleanliness. Before requesting installation, homeowners typically want to understand the types of filters available, how they integrate with current systems, and the maintenance requirements to ensure long-lasting performance.

Property owners considering carbon filter installation should also evaluate the size and capacity of the filters needed for their space, as well as any compatibility considerations with existing heating or cooling equipment. It’s helpful to clarify the specific indoor air concerns they aim to address, whether it’s odor control, chemical removal, or allergen reduction. Understanding these factors can help ensure the selected filter system effectively meets the needs of the property, providing cleaner, fresher indoor air.

Carbon Filter Installation Questions

What is a carbon filter used for? A carbon filter helps remove odors, gases, and airborne pollutants from indoor air or ventilation systems, improving air quality in residential properties.

Where can a carbon filter be installed? Carbon filters can be installed in HVAC systems, kitchen exhausts, or standalone units to target specific areas needing air purification.

How often should a carbon filter be replaced? Replacement frequency depends on usage and air quality, but typically every 6 to 12 months is recommended for optimal performance.

What types of projects commonly require carbon filter installation? Projects often include improving indoor air quality in homes, replacing filters in ventilation systems, or upgrading existing air purification setups.
